1. Understanding the Units: Kilograms and Pounds

Before diving into the conversion, let's clarify the units involved. The kilogram (kg) is the base unit of mass in the International System of Units (SI), commonly used in science and most of the world. The pound (lb) is a unit of mass in the imperial system, primarily used in the United States. While both measure mass, they use different scales. Therefore, a direct numerical comparison isn't possible without conversion.

2. The Conversion Factor: The Bridge Between Kilograms and Pounds

The key to converting between kilograms and pounds lies in the conversion factor. One kilogram is approximately equal to 2.20462 pounds. This means for every one kilogram, there are 2.20462 pounds. This factor acts as the bridge between the two measurement systems. We'll use this factor to perform our conversion.

3. Calculating 54 kg to lb: A Step-by-Step Guide

To convert 54 kilograms to pounds, we simply multiply the number of kilograms by the conversion factor: 54 kg 2.20462 lb/kg = 119.046 lb Therefore, 54 kilograms is approximately equal to 119.05 pounds. Note that we rounded the result to two decimal places for practicality. In many cases, rounding to the nearest pound (119 lb) would be sufficient depending on the context.

5. Beyond 54 kg: Performing Your Own Conversions

The method outlined above applies to any kilogram-to-pound conversion. Simply multiply the weight in kilograms by 2.20462 to obtain the equivalent weight in pounds. For instance: 70 kg 2.20462 lb/kg ≈ 154.32 lb 25 kg 2.20462 lb/kg ≈ 55.12 lb
